New Life Centre is a charitable organization based in Moose Jaw, Saskatchewan, classified by the CRA under christianity.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, it reported $137K in revenue and $112K in expenditures.
Its funding that year was roughly 84% from donations, 15% from other charities.
Compared with 14,125 religious char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 17% of peers. Its highest-paid position fell in the $40,000–79,999 range. The charity reported 1 permanent full-time position.
It reported gifts to 7 qualified donees totalling $13K in 2024, the largest being $5,100 to The Pentecostal Assemblies of Canada/les Assemblees de la Pentecote du Canada.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$86K in 2020 to $137K in 2024.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 3 names.

The ledger, 2020–2024
| Year | Revenue | Spending | Programs | Fundraising | Gifts out | Net assets |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| $137K | $112K | $31K | — | $13K | $556K |
| 2023 | $122K | $142K | $108K | $0 | $6,872 | $529K |
| 2022 | $167K | $183K | $172K | — | $17K | $551K |
| 2021 | $109K | $64K | $47K | — | $14K | $529K |
| 2020 | $86K | $73K | $58K | — | $11K | $518K |
Revenue printed in red where the year ran a deficit. Fiscal years by period end.
